AUSTIN, Texas, March 31 /PRNewswire/ -- The 15th annual South by Southwest (SXSW) Interactive Festival, a leading festival targeting Web technology innovators and digital creatives from across the globe, generated the largest number of attendees in the event's history with more than 9,000 Interactive, Gold and Platinum registrants in attendance. This marks a 30 percent registration growth over the 2007 Interactive Festival.
"SXSW Interactive experienced considerable growth in 2008 but, more importantly, it scaled a lot better this year than in previous years," said SXSW Interactive Director, Hugh Forrest. "We were able to create a number of smaller events within this larger event, thus helping to retain the look and feel and the one-on-one interactions that people traditionally like so much about SXSW."
The five-day festival, which concluded earlier this month, featured over 150 panels, dozens of networking events and parties, a keynote interview with Facebook founder and CEO Mark Zuckerberg, and keynote presentations by Frank Warren of the PostSecret Project, renowned video game designer Jane McGonigal and Henry Jenkins, Co-Director of the Comparative Media Studies Program at MIT.
In addition to record-breaking registration numbers and noteworthy keynote speakers, highlights from the SXSW Interactive Festival include the ScreenBurn Arcade, which featured gaming tournaments and an opportunity for consumers to experience up-and-coming game titles first-hand, and the 11th annual Web Awards ceremony hosted by comedian Eugene Mirman.
